Radiator upgrades in Haddington are sized from the room and intended flow temperature, not by copying the old panel dimensions. We replace corroded or underperforming emitters, adapt imperial pipe centres where necessary and rebalance the whole circuit afterwards. For heat-pump preparation, lower-temperature output is checked room by room so only the emitters that genuinely need changing are included. Do heat pumps always require larger radiators?+
Not always. We calculate each room and often find only selected emitters need upsizing.
Can old pipe centres be reused?+
Usually, using the right radiator width or neat pipe adjustments agreed before work starts.
